    the reason why you fight the "same" enemy is not because they can't die per se, but rather, that you are not actually fighting the same person every time.
    it's how every normal dog enemy looks the same, but are not the same dog obviously.
    there is also lore reason as to why you face certain enemies more often.
    the crucible knights as an example are faced multiple times in combat, but they are not the same person, rather part of the same unit/faction.
    obviously there is also a gameplay and resource management side to it, by having enemies be bosses multiple times.

    They definitely reuse bosses a lot. But I do like the way they do it. Either by fighting astral forms Vs physical forms (like Godfrey or Mohg) or in the case of others, fighting them under different circumstances (godskin duo vs the apostle or noble on their own) or they give them a modified move set (Draconic tree sentinel, or margit/morgott)
    They find a decent (not perfect) balance between reusing assets and tweaking them just enough to feel fresh one way or another.
    There’s definitely exceptions to this. But overall, I think they did a good job with pasting bosses to other later areas in a new way.
